Incorporating the learning effect into data envelopment analysis to measure MSW recycling performance
Authors:Dong-Shang Chang  Wenrong Liu  Li-Ting Yeh
Institution:1. Department of Business Administration, National Central University, 300 Jhongda Rd., Jhongli City, Taoyuan County 320, Taiwan, ROC;2. Department of Cooperative Economics, Feng Chia University, 100 Wenhwa Rd., Seatwen, Taichung 407, Taiwan, ROC
Abstract:The effect of organizational learning, which results in continuous improvement of organizational performance over time, has been widely discussed. The cumulative learning effect may form as a source of intellectual capital. Thus far, the static data envelopment analysis (DEA) model has not been used to examine the longitudinal learning effect. Therefore, a two-stage approach is developed together with the estimation of a latent learning effect using time-series data; the estimated learning effect is then used as an input in the DEA Slacks-Based Measure (SBM) model. The proposed DEA SBM model can be used to investigate the efficiency of the organizational learning effect of Municipal Solid Waste (MSW) recycling systems.
Keywords:Data envelopment analysis  Learning effect  MSW recycling
